是指利用Python中的正则表达式模块re,结合列表解析的语法,对文本进行匹配和处理的一种方法。
正则表达式是一种用来描述、匹配和操作字符串的强大工具。它通过使用特定的字符和语法规则,可以快速地在文本中搜索、替换、提取符合特定模式的字符串。
Python中的re模块提供了一系列函数,用于处理正则表达式。其中,常用的函数包括:
列表解析是Python中一种简洁的语法,用于创建新的列表。它的基本形式是在一个方括号内,包含一个表达式和一个可迭代对象,通过对可迭代对象中的每个元素应用表达式,生成新的列表。
在文本上使用正则表达式的Python列表解析,可以通过将正则表达式的匹配结果作为列表解析的可迭代对象,对文本进行匹配和处理。例如,可以使用re.findall()函数获取所有匹配的子串,并将其作为列表解析的可迭代对象,对每个匹配结果进行进一步处理或筛选。
这种方法在文本处理、数据清洗、信息提取等场景中非常常见。例如,可以使用正则表达式和列表解析从一段文本中提取出所有的URL链接、电子邮件地址等信息。
腾讯云提供了云计算相关的产品和服务,其中与文本处理和正则表达式相关的产品包括:
以上是腾讯云提供的一些与文本处理和正则表达式相关的产品和服务,可以根据具体需求选择适合的产品进行开发和部署。
北极星训练营
企业创新在线学堂
高校公开课
云+社区沙龙online [云原生技术实践]
算法大赛
一体化监控解决方案
北极星训练营
腾讯云数据湖专题直播
新知
领取专属 10元无门槛券
手把手带您无忧上云